The chilipad remote is easy to use and it worked right out of package for me. You will require to provide your own batteries. The remote is fairly easy, it has an on/off button and then a hot and cool button. The temperature reading is backlit so you can adjust the temp in dark without having to switch on the lights.
That said, it did make my mattress feel a little firmer. The Chilipad will make sounds in the evening as water goes through the system. This is comparable to the quantity of noise made by a white sound machine and something you will get used to after a few nights. I sleep with a white sound maker currently so just turned it off and count on the hum of the Chilipad.
In regards to volume, I found it similar to the whir of a computer fan running. This device heat up a bed mattress quickly but the real advantage of the Chilipad is its ability to cool a mattress. The Cube should be positioned on a flat surface area with the water tank facing up and a minimum of 2 feet (2?) of breathing space on all sides.
The Cube weighs roughly nine pounds, so ensuring the surface area can support that much weight is essential. It should also be placed within 8 feet (8?) of an air conditioning outlet unless an extension cord is used. Chili Technology recommends utilizing distilled water, and to add a capful of hydrogen peroxide whenever the water tank is full.
Yes. According to Chili Technology, the average Chilipad expenses 18 cents per night to utilize. This can save property owners cash if their typical heating/cooling costs exceed this quantity. No. The Chilipad is solely designed as a sleep aid, and should not be run as a heating/cooling representative when owners are not in bed.

When Wirecutter's sleep group put out the call for somebody to check the Chili, Pad (with the Cube Sleep System), I volunteered Carter.Electric blankets and heated mattress pads have been around for decades, however cooling contraptions like the Chili, Pad and Bed, Jet are more recent developments. All of these systems are expensive, with the Chili, Pad starting at$700 for a single-person mat that covers only half of a queen-size bed. The Chili, Pad lies flat beneath your fitted sheet, and it's reversible, with a mesh side created for cooler sleep and a cotton-polyester blend on the other side for those(like me)who choose a warmer bed.
